…General term for mammals belonging to the order Chiroptera, suborder Macrochiroptera, family Pteropodidae. They eat fruit or pollen, have thin snouts, large eyes, and faces resembling those of a fox. *Some of the terminology that mentions "Pteropodidae" is listed below.
